Every Glider And How To Get Them
You get gliders in Palworld by eitherunlocking crafting recipesfor gliders, orobtaining certain palsthat will act as gliders if you have them in your party.
The first glider iseasy to obtain and craft. The remaining ones will take a bit more time to get, but they come withfaster speedsandless stamina drain.

Here’s every glider you can get in the game,how to unlock the recipe, and how to craft them.

The Hyper Glider is the fastest Glideryou can craft, but it will take some effort asyou need tolevel up to 52and gather some materials that can be found during the late game. You also need tobuild Production Assembly Line IIto craft it.
The Production Assembly Line II can be crafted at level 42 using 100 Refined Ingots, ten Circuit Boards, and 30 Nails.
What Alternative Gliders Are There?
Some pals in the game willact as glidersas long as youkeep them in your party. Pals likeCelaray,Hangyu, orKillamari.
Whether or not you have a glider equipped,these pals will be your gliderwhenever you jump and pull your parachute. And with these guys, depending on the pal, yourgliding speed and stamina drain may be betterthan your equipped parachute.
Once you’ve caught one of these pals,you’ll need to then craft the appropriate glovesto be able to use them as your glider.
